He's A Philanthropist

John Stamos loves kids. It's a good thing, considering all of the time he spent on the set of Full House. He and his wife started a jewelry line in 2018, which donates all of its proceeds to the children's help organization, Child Help.

The jewelry line has been named St. Amos Jewelry. Kudos to John! Seems there really is an Uncle Jesse in his heart. In many snapshots of John, he is seen reaching out to children in need.

His Own Star

John Stamos has enjoyed a remarkably successful career. He has his own star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ame, which he received in 2019 for his work on TV and Broadway.

Family Matters

John Stamos has a close-knit family and entered into acting with his father's blessing. He had enrolled at Cypress College when he left school and was due to start studying in 1981. However, it seemed life had other plans for him.

He decided to focus on his acting career instead and left college during his first term to dedicate the time to acting. His family supported his decision.

High-Profile Friends

John Stamos has some high profile friends and colleagues. It's little wonder, considering he is quite the star himself. He grew up besotted with the Beach Boys music and even went to watch one of their concerts when he was 15 years old.

Later, he would have the privilege of actually touring with the band as part of their musical ensemble. For these tours, he assisted on drums and guitar. Just like his character, Uncle Jesse, John really is a whiz when it comes to music.

It's not just John Stamos's good looks that have earned him a good reputation and career success. He is no stranger to hard work and isn't afraid to roll up his sleeves to get things done. Stamos started his working career early, flipping burgers for his father's Yellow Basket restaurant. He learned from the experience to put discipline and hard work into everything he did and it was at his father's insistence that the young man should lend a helping hand.

Seems the hard work definitely set him up for the dedication he'd need in his future to ensure success. While all this burger-flipping was going on, John was honing his skills as a musician, drumming for the John F.Kennedy High School marching band.

Broadway Star

John Stamos doesn't just shine on the TV screen. He is also a star on stage, and in 2009, he won a Golden Icon Award for his performance in Bye Bye Birdie on Broadway.

His award was for best actor in the musical production. His ability to perform live, be it behind the drums or guitar, or as a character in a story, is one of the reasons he is so sought after as an actor.

Maintains Strong Ties

It would seem that John Stamos has maintained strong ties with the cast of Full House following the show's end in 1995. He continues to be good friends with Bob Saget and has shown strong support for Jodie Sweetin's endeavors to help people overcome addiction.
